A Certificate Programme in Mathematical Logic and Computability provides a focused exploration of fundamental concepts in mathematical logic, including propositional and predicate logic, model theory, and computability theory. Students gain a solid understanding of formal systems and their limitations, crucial for advanced computer science and related fields.
Learning outcomes typically include proficiency in formal proof techniques, understanding of decidability and undecidability, and familiarity with Turing machines and other computational models. The program equips students with rigorous analytical skills applicable to diverse problem-solving scenarios. This strong foundation in theoretical computer science is highly valuable.
The duration of a Certificate Programme in Mathematical Logic and Computability varies depending on the institution, but generally ranges from several months to a year of part-time or full-time study. The intensity and workload are tailored to the specific program structure and the level of prior mathematical background assumed.
Industry relevance is substantial. A deep understanding of mathematical logic and computability is increasingly sought after in areas such as software verification, artificial intelligence (AI), database design, cryptography, and theoretical computer science research. Graduates often find opportunities in tech companies, research institutions, and academia, leveraging their expertise in formal methods and algorithm analysis.
